The CData ODBC Driver for Cvent makes it easy to integrate connectivity to live Cvent のデータ with standard data access components in C++Builder. This article shows how to create a simple visual component library (VCL) application in C++Builder that connects to Cvent のデータ, executes queries, and displays the results in a grid. An additional section shows how to use FireDAC components to execute commands from code.

Create a Connection to Cvent データ

If you have not already, first specify connection properties in an ODBC DSN (data source name). This is the last step of the driver installation. You can use the Microsoft ODBC Data Source Administrator to create and configure ODBC DSNs.

Cvent への認証を行う前に、ワークスペースとOAuth アプリケーションを作成する必要があります。

ワークスペースの作成

ワークスペースを作成するには:

  1. Cvent にサインインし、App Switcher(ページ右上の青いボタン) -> Admin に移動します。
  2. Admin メニューから、Integrations -> REST API に移動します。
  3. Developer Management の新しいタブが立ち上がります。新しいタブでManage API Access をクリックします。
  4. Workspace を作成し、名前を付けます。開発者にアクセスさせたいスコープを選択します。スコープは、開発者がアクセスできるデータドメインを制御します。
    • All を選択すると、開発者は任意のスコープ、およびREST API にこれから追加されるスコープを選択できます。
    • Custom を選択すると、開発者がOAuth アプリで選択できるスコープを、選択したスコープに制限できます。本製品によって公開されるすべてのテーブルにアクセスするには、次のスコープを設定する必要があります。
      event/attendees:readevent/attendees:writeevent/contacts:read
      event/contacts:writeevent/custom-fields:readevent/custom-fields:write
      event/events:readevent/events:writeevent/sessions:delete
      event/sessions:readevent/sessions:writeevent/speakers:delete
      event/speakers:readevent/speakers:writebudget/budget-items:read
      budget/budget-items:writeexhibitor/exhibitors:readexhibitor/exhibitors:write
      survey/surveys:readsurvey/surveys:write

OAuth アプリケーションの作成

Workspace を設定して招待すると、開発者はサインアップしてカスタムOAuth アプリを作成できます。手順については、ヘルプドキュメントカスタムOAuth アプリケーションの作成を参照してください。

Cvent への接続

OAuth アプリケーションを作成したら、次の接続プロパティを設定してCvent に接続します。

  • InitiateOAuthGETANDREFRESH。OAuthAccessToken を自動的に取得およびリフレッシュするために使用します。
  • OAuthClientId:OAuth アプリケーションに関連付けられたClient ID。これは、Cvent Developer Portal のApplications page ページにあります。
  • OAuthClientSecret:OAuth アプリケーションに関連付けられたClient secret。これは、Cvent Developer Portal のApplications page ページにあります。

You can then follow the steps below to use the Data Explorer to create a FireDAC connection to Cvent.

  1. In a new VCL Forms application, expand the FireDAC node in the Data Explorer.
  2. Right-click the ODBC Data Source node in the Data Explorer.
  3. Click Add New Connection.
  4. Enter a name for the connection.
  5. In the FireDAC Connection Editor that appears, set the DataSource property to the name of the ODBC DSN for Cvent.

Create VCL Applications with Connectivity to Cvent データ

Follow the procedure below to start querying Cvent のデータ from a simple VCL application that displays the results of a query in a grid.

  1. Drop a TFDConnection component onto the form and set the following properties:

    • ConnectionDefName: Select the FireDAC connection to Cvent.
    • Connected: Select True from the menu and, in the dialog that appears, enter your credentials.
  2. Drop a TFDQuery component onto the form and set the properties below:

    • Connection: Set this property to the TFDConnection component, if this component is not already specified.
    • SQL: Click the button in the SQL property and enter a query. For example:

      SELECT Id, Title FROM Events WHERE Virtual = 'true'
    • Active: Set this property to true.
  3. Drop a TDataSource component onto the form and set the following property:

    • DataSet: In the menu for this property, select the name of the TFDQuery component.
  4. Drop a TDBGrid control onto the form and set the following property:

    • DataSource: Select the name of the TDataSource.
  5. Drop a TFDGUIxWaitCursor onto the form — this is required to avoid a run-time error.

Execute Commands to Cvent with FireDAC Components

You can use the TFDConnection and TFQuery components to execute queries to Cvent のデータ. This section provides cventspecific examples of executing queries with the TFQuery component.

Connect to Cvent データ

To connect to the data source, set the Connected property of the TFDConnection component to true. You can set the same properties from code:

FDConnection1->ConnectionDefName = "CData Cvent ODBC Source"; FDConnection1->Connected = true;

To connect the TFDQuery component to Cvent のデータ, set the Connection property of the component. When a TFDQuery component is added at design time, its Connection property is automatically set to point to a TFDConnection on the form, as in the application above.

Create Parameterized Queries

To create a parameterized query, use the following syntax below:

FDQuery1->SQL->Text = "select * from Events where virtual = :Virtual"; FDQuery1->ParamByName("virtual")->AsString = "true"; query->Open();

The example above binds a string-type input parameter by name and then opens the dataset that results.

Prepare the Statement

Preparing statements is costly in system resources and time. The connection must be active and open while a statement is prepared. By default, FireDAC prepares the query to avoid recompiling the same query over and over. To disable statement preparation, set ResourceOptions.DirectExecute to True; for example, when you need to execute a query only once.

Execute a Query

To execute a query that returns a result set, such as a select query, use the Open method. The Open method executes the query, returns the result set, and opens it. The Open method will return an error if the query does not produce a result set.

FDQuery1->SQL->Text := "select * from Events where virtual = :Virtual"; FDQuery1.ParamByName("virtual")->AsString = "true"; FDQuery1->Open();

To execute a query that does not return a result set, use the ExecSQL method. The ExecSQL method will return an error if the query returns a result set. To retrieve the count of affected rows use the TFD.RowsAffected property.

FDQ.SQL.Text := "delete from Events where Id = :Id"; FDQuery1->Params->Items[0]->AsString = "x12345"; FDQuery1->ExecSQL(); AnsiString i = FDQuery1->RowsAffected;
